Today’ Agenda Introduction Preparation of the ore production of the metals Purification of the Metals

Metallurgy Metallurgy“ The process of isolating the metal from an ore ” Ore: the starting material for obtaining a metal. It a complex mixture of the metallic matter and impurities. The isolation of a metal from its ore involves THREE major steps: Ore dressed ore impure metal pure metal 3 2 1

Preliminary treatment Steps Preparation of the ore Preliminary treatment after – treatment Production of the metal Conversion of metal to oxide Reduction of the metal oxides Purification of the metal Liquation Distillation Chemical method Zone refining

Preparation of the ore The preliminary treatment Crushing, grinding Washing off Removement of unwanted material b) After – treatment (Concentration of ore) By gravity methods Magnetic method Froth floating method leaching Liquation

b) After – treatment (Concentration of ore) 4- Leaching Al2O3 + NaOH (aq) + H2O 2NaAl(OH)4 (aq) NaAl(OH)4 (aq) Al(OH)3 Al(OH)3 Al2O3 (s) + 3H2O (g) CO2 1200 oC

Production of the metal Conversion of ore to oxide Calcination Roasting Reduction of the metal oxides Auto – reduction Chemical reduction Electrolysis

Production of the metal Calcination CaCO3 CaO + CO2 The calcination is performed in a reverberatory furnace

Production of the metal Roasting 2Cu2S + 3O2 2Cu2O + 2SO2 CuS + 2O2 2CuSO4 Reduction of the metal oxides Auto – reduction 2HgS + 3O2 2HgO + 2SO2  2HgO 2Hg + O2 Chemical reduction PbO + H2 Pb + H2O

Purification of the metal Liquation.   Poling. Distillation. Electrolysis. Complexation. The Van Arkel – Boer purification of metals

Purification of the metal Liquation.  This method can be used only when the m.p. of the metal is less than those of its impurities. Poling This method is suitable for purifying a metal contaminated with its oxide impurity. Distillation The metal to be refined is heated above its b.p. in a retort and the vapor is condensed to pure metal.

Purification of the metal Electrolysis. Anode : Cu(s) Cu2+ (aq) + 2℮- Cathode : Cu2+ (aq) + 2℮- Cu(s)

Purification of the metal Complexation. Ni(s) + 4CO (g) Ni(CO)4 (g) Ni(CO)4 (g) Ni(s) + CO (g) The Van Arkel – Boer purification of metals Ti (s) + 2I2 TiI4 (g) Ti (s) + 2I2 50-250°C 1400°C
